In Bengali ( I born in West Bengal) Mother - maa / mamoni Father - Baba / Bapi Sister - bon ( younger)/ didivai (elder) Brother - Bhai (younger)/ Dadavai (elder) Mother's sister - masimoni / masi ( younger) , boro maa ( elder than your mother ) Mother's brother - Mama Mother's mother - Dida / Didun / Didima Mother's father - Dadu Father's sister - pisimoni / pisi Father's brother - Kaku / Kaka ( younger), Jethu ( elder than your father ) Father's mother - Thamma, Thammi , Thakuma Father's father - Thakurda My mother tongue santhali - Mother - maa / yu / gogo Father - baba / apunj Sister - Didi / Dayee Brother - Dada Mother's sister - Kaki / masi Mother's brother - mama Mother's father - Dadu Mother's mother - Mamayu Father's sister - jhigom / jhi and her husband kumang Father's brother - jetha / kaku Father's mother - babayu Father's father - Baa gom / dadu
